Blood and organ concentrations of tetracycline and doxycycline in female mice. Comparison to males.

R Böcker, L Warnke, C J Estler.   

Abstract

In mice treated with 50 micrograms/g i.v. tetracycline (TC) or doxycycline (DC), respectively, drug concentrations have been measured in serum, whole blood, liver, kidneys, lungs, heart, skeletal muscle and bones. TC reached especially high concentrations in liver, kidneys and bones. DC was initially trapped by lung tissue and accumulated in liver and kidneys. Liver concentrations were higher for TC, kidney concentrations were higher for DC. In some tissues, e.g. liver and kidneys, TC and DC reached higher concentrations in females than in males.
